Transaction 360631dc66230cbfd6ae2c4243653b75f8e282930bfa853af1b139e9d0d7114a
1 Input
1 Output
-
360631dc66230cbfd6ae2c4243653b75f8e282930bfa853af1b139e9d0d7114a:0
- value
- 691586
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ecd396b86c6c7151aa058a21d524bcc52113b816 OP_EQUAL
- address
- 3PHEsG2ePGnuPNEzuuG2Q6LHTDNgTQQoGE